How to Add Integers to Smartboard

The Smartboard is an interactive whiteboard used for educational and business presentations. The Smartboard setup consists of a freestanding or wall-mounted whiteboard, a projector, and computer with Smartboard software and touch screen capability. Integers on the Smartboard can be drawn with your finger, the Smart Pen Tray, or with an interactive pen (if supplied with your Smartboard). The Smartboard can translate your pen or finger movements to integers in many common applications, including Microsoft Word.

Instructions

    • 1

      Make sure that the InkAware toolbar is showing. The InkAware software is either a series of three buttons in the main toolbar or a free-floating window of three buttons. If the InkAware toolbar is not showing, click on "View->Toolbars->SMART Aware Toolbar."

    • 2

      Pick up a pen from the pen tray.

    • 3

      Write an integer on the interactive whiteboard.

    • 4

      Press the "Insert as Image" button on the SmartAware toolbar to add the integer to the Word document as an image.

Tips & Warnings

  • The best position for Smartboard readings is to have your fingers at right angles to the screen.

  • Change pen colors by picking up a different colored pen.

  • Loose clothing (like flapping cuffs) can trigger inaccurate Smatboard responses. For best results, don't wear baggy clothing or loose bracelets on your writing hand.
